Company Background:
Washington Equipment Manufacturing Company, Inc. (WEMCO, Inc.) is a contract manufacturer that specializes in the design, engineering, and manufacturing of productivity-enhancing solutions, such as overhead cranes for material handling, automated aerospace tooling and parts, agricultural equipment, and custom machinery used in multiple industries around the world. WEMCO, Inc. was founded on the principles of innovative design and quality workmanship, and our founding partners have more than 70 combined years of experience as welders, fitters, engineers, and heavy machinery designers. WEMCO, Inc.’s facility is fully integrated with the capability to perform nearly all services in-house. Our current capabilities include design, engineering, welding, machining, painting, assembly, testing, and installation of complex machinery.
Job Purpose:
As a Structural Engineer Intern, you will work under the direction of a Structural Engineer PE, as part of a multi-disciplinary design and engineering team to support the manufacturing, installation, and commissioning of mechanized structural systems such as gantry and overhead bridge cranes. The ideal candidate will grow and develop in their own abilities and interests together with the company.
Job Responsibilities:
Provide support with the assessment of project requirements
Support the Senior Structural Engineer in coordinating structural systems with mechanical and electrical systems
Perform analysis, design and detailing of mechanized structural systems using structural principles, software, building codes, and specifications
Produce structural calculations and drawings
Interface with field personnel and purchasing to determine and obtain required materials
Support the Engineering Team with the creation of O&M manuals
Develop and maintain constructive and cooperative interpersonal working relationships with others
Be willing to travel for short periods of time to assist with managing project assignments
Be willing to study and learn relevant industry standards such as AWS, AISC, IBC, ANSI, ASME, and CMAA, as well as any other related specifications required for producing industry-accepted designs and equipment
Assist the Senior Structural Engineer in coordinating design work with clients, project teams, contractors, as well as other design professionals including Architects and other Engineering disciplines.
Perform engineering assignments that may require critical thinking and creativity to address unique structural elements that have limited or no specific code-based guidance.
Work independently on small project tasks or assists senior engineers on larger projects.
